Did you know that more than 28% of U.S. adults have a disability? That’s more than 1 in 4 people. Healthcare providers regularly interact with patients who have visible and invisible disabilities—but without intentional training, well-meaning caregivers may fall short.

Person-centered training on disability awareness helps healthcare teams:
• Break down care barriers and builds trust
• Create a culture of inclusion, respect, and empowerment
• Signal leadership in advancing health equity and patient satisfaction
